Principi fondamentali per la sicurezza nella distribuzione di tecnologie digitali

La sicurezza nella distribuzione tecnologica si basa su principi chiave che devono essere integrati fin dall’inizio del processo. Questi includono la protezione dell’integrità del prodotto, la garanzia di autenticità e la tutela dei dati sensibili. È fondamentale adottare un approccio multilivello, combinando tecnologie di crittografia, sistemi di autenticazione e procedure di verifica.

Ad esempio, molte aziende europee implementano sistemi di firma digitale per garantire che i software distribuiti siano autentici e non alterati. Questo metodo si basa su standard come il European Electronic Identification and Trust Services (eIDAS), che assicura l’autenticità delle firme elettroniche e delle attestazioni di conformità.

Norme europee vigenti che regolano la distribuzione di software e hardware

Le normative europee sono progettate per assicurare che la distribuzione di tecnologie sia sicura, trasparente e rispettosa dei diritti dei consumatori e delle imprese. Tra le principali si annoverano:

  • Direttiva sulla sicurezza delle reti e dell’informazione (NIS2): mira a rafforzare la sicurezza delle infrastrutture critiche e dei servizi digitali, imponendo agli operatori di reti e servizi digitali di adottare misure di sicurezza appropriate.
  • Regolamento eIDAS: stabilisce un quadro normativo per le identità elettroniche e le firme digitali, garantendo l’interoperabilità e la validità legale delle attestazioni di conformità.
  • Direttiva sulla conformità digitale (DSM): in fase di sviluppo, mira a regolamentare la conformità dei prodotti digitali, assicurando che hardware e software rispettino requisiti di sicurezza e privacy.

Implementazione di sistemi di protezione dei dati durante la distribuzione

Crittografia e gestione delle chiavi per la protezione delle informazioni sensibili

La crittografia rappresenta una delle tecniche più efficaci per proteggere i dati sensibili durante la distribuzione. Le aziende devono adottare algoritmi robusti, come AES-256, e gestire in modo sicuro le chiavi di crittografia tramite sistemi di gestione delle chiavi (KMS).

Un esempio pratico è l’utilizzo di protocolli TLS (Transport Layer Security) per cifrare le comunicazioni tra server e client durante il download di software o firmware, prevenendo intercettazioni e manomissioni.

Procedure di auditing e monitoraggio continuo delle distribuzioni

Il monitoraggio continuo permette di individuare tempestivamente anomalie o attività sospette. Le aziende devono implementare procedure di auditing periodiche, verificando integrità, autenticità e conformità dei prodotti distribuiti.

Strumenti come i sistemi di logging, i sistemi di intrusion detection e le piattaforme di analisi comportamentale sono essenziali per mantenere un livello di sicurezza elevato e rispettare le normative sulla protezione dei dati, come il GDPR.

Soluzioni di autenticazione e autorizzazione per accessi sicuri

Per garantire che solo utenti autorizzati possano accedere ai sistemi di distribuzione, si adottano soluzioni di autenticazione multifattoriale (MFA), gestione delle identità e accessi (IAM) e sistemi di single sign-on (SSO). Queste tecnologie riducono il rischio di accessi non autorizzati e migliorano la tracciabilità delle operazioni.

1. Selecting and Integrating Advanced Data Sources for Hyper-Personalization

a) Identifying High-Quality, Relevant Data Sets (CRM, Behavioral Analytics, Third-Party Data)

The foundation of micro-targeted personalization lies in acquiring high-fidelity, relevant data. Start by auditing your existing CRM systems to extract rich customer profiles, including purchase history, preferences, and interaction logs. Complement this with behavioral analytics tools such as Heap, Mixpanel, or Pendo to track user actions like page views, click streams, and session durations. Incorporate third-party data sources like demographic databases, intent signals from social media, or purchasing intent data from providers like Nielsen or Acxiom to fill gaps and add context. Prioritize data sources that offer real-time or near-real-time updates to enable dynamic personalization.

b) Techniques for Combining Multiple Data Streams Without Data Silos

To prevent data silos, establish a unified data architecture using cloud-based data integration platforms such as Segment, mParticle, or Snowflake. Use APIs and event-driven architectures to stream data into a central Customer Data Platform (CDP). Implement an 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) process that standardizes data formats and resolves conflicts across sources. Employ schema mapping and data normalization techniques—such as defining common identifiers (email, device ID, or user ID)—to merge data streams into comprehensive user profiles. Regularly audit data pipelines for latency and completeness to ensure synchronization accuracy.

c) Step-by-Step Guide to Data Validation and Cleansing for Accurate Personalization

  1. Schema Validation: Verify data conforms to predefined schemas, rejecting or flagging anomalies.
  2. Duplicate Detection: Use algorithms like fuzzy matching or clustering to identify and merge duplicate records.
  3. Outlier Detection: Apply statistical methods (e.g., Z-score, IQR) to flag inconsistent data points.
  4. Data Enrichment: Fill missing values with predictive models or external sources, ensuring completeness.
  5. Regular Audits: Schedule periodic data quality reviews and establish automated alerts for data drift or anomalies.

d) Case Study: Implementing a Data Integration Pipeline for Real-Time Personalization

A leading e-commerce platform integrated their CRM, behavioral analytics, and third-party intent data into a Snowflake data warehouse, orchestrated via Apache Kafka for real-time streaming. Using a custom ETL pipeline built with Apache Spark, they cleansed and validated data continuously, then fed it into a real-time personalization engine powered by Redis and GraphQL APIs. This setup enabled dynamic content adjustments based on recent user actions, increasing engagement by 25% within three months. Key success factors included rigorous data validation, latency optimization, and a modular architecture allowing easy scalability.

2. Building and Fine-Tuning User Segmentation Models for Micro-Targeting

a) Creating Dynamic Segmentation Criteria Based on Behavioral Signals

Move beyond static demographic segments by defining dynamic criteria rooted in behavioral signals. For example, classify users as “High Intent Shoppers” if they have added items to cart but not purchased in the last 48 hours, or “Engaged Browsers” if they have viewed more than five product pages within a session. Use real-time event streams to update these segments as user behaviors evolve. Implement logical rules such as if-then conditions, combined with weighted signals (e.g., recency, frequency, monetary value), to refine segment definitions continuously.

b) Utilizing Machine Learning to Automate and Evolve Segments

Leverage clustering algorithms like K-Means or DBSCAN on high-dimensional behavioral data to discover natural user groupings. For more nuanced segmentation, deploy supervised models such as XGBoost or Random Forests trained on historical conversion data to predict the likelihood of engagement or purchase. Implement an active learning loop where segments are periodically re-evaluated based on model feedback and new data, enabling continuous evolution without manual intervention.

c) Practical Approach to Testing and Validating Segment Effectiveness

Tip: Always conduct A/B tests comparing personalized content tailored to a segment against a control group. Track key metrics such as click-through rate (CTR), conversion rate, and average order value (AOV). Use statistical significance testing (e.g., chi-square, t-test) to validate improvements before scaling.

Maintain a segment performance dashboard that logs these metrics over time, enabling quick identification of underperforming segments for further refinement. Incorporate user feedback and behavioral shifts into the model retraining process to keep segments relevant and effective.

d) Example: Segmenting Users by Intent and Engagement Levels for Tailored Content

For instance, create segments such as “Ready-to-Burchase” (users with recent cart activity and high engagement), “Research Phase” (users browsing multiple categories without recent activity), and “Lapsed Users” (long inactivity). Use these segments to dynamically serve personalized emails, targeted ads, or on-site content, ensuring relevance and increasing the likelihood of conversion.

3. Developing Personalized Content Algorithms and Rules

a) Designing Rules for Content Delivery Based on User Attributes and Actions

Start by defining if-then rules that map user attributes to specific content variations. For example, if user location is in California, serve region-specific promotions; if user has viewed a product multiple times, prioritize showing related accessories. Use rule engines like Drools or Apache Jena to manage complex rule sets, allowing non-technical teams to update rules without developer intervention. Regularly review and update rules based on performance metrics and new insights.

b) Implementing Predictive Models to Anticipate User Needs

Build models such as Collaborative Filtering or Sequential Pattern Mining to predict what content users are likely to engage with next. For example, using session data, train a recurrent neural network (RNN) to forecast the next product a user might add to cart. Integrate these models into your content delivery pipeline, enabling real-time recommendations that adapt to user behavior as it unfolds.

c) Combining Static Rules and Dynamic Machine Learning Outputs for Optimal Results

Create a layered approach where static rules handle high-confidence cases (e.g., geographic targeting), while machine learning models handle nuanced, context-dependent personalization. Use a decision tree or a weighted scoring system to determine which rule or model output takes precedence. For example, if a user is identified as “High Engagement” via rules, prioritize high-value recommendations from ML models; if not, fall back to generic content.

d) Example: Real-Time Content Adjustment Using User Interaction Data

Implement event-driven architecture where user clicks, scrolls, and time spent influence content adjustment. For instance, if a user interacts with certain categories frequently, dynamically boost related products or articles in the feed. Use tools like Apache Kafka for real-time event streaming and TensorFlow Serving for deploying predictive models in production. This creates a feedback loop that refines personalization on the fly.

4. Implementing Real-Time Personalization Engines

a) Technical Architecture: Choosing the Right Technology Stack (APIs, Middleware, CDPs)

Design an architecture that integrates your data sources with your content delivery platform via APIs. Use middleware like Node.js or Apache NiFi to orchestrate data flow. Implement a CDP such as Treasure Data or BlueConic that consolidates data in real time. For content rendering, leverage edge computing or serverless functions (e.g., AWS Lambda) to minimize latency and ensure scalability.

b) Step-by-Step Setup of a Personalization Workflow (Data Capture, Processing, Content Delivery)

  1. Data Capture: Instrument your website or app with event tracking pixels and SDKs to collect user actions.
  2. Data Processing: Stream data into your pipeline, validate, and enrich it using ETL jobs or serverless functions.
  3. Content Delivery: Use a real-time API to serve personalized content based on updated user profiles.

c) Ensuring Low Latency for Seamless User Experience

Optimize every layer: CDN caching for static assets, in-memory databases like Redis for session data, and edge computing for personalized content rendering. Use asynchronous data fetching and pre-fetching strategies to reduce wait times. Regularly monitor system latency and scale infrastructure proactively to handle peak loads.

d)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Performance Bottlenecks

  • Data Latency: Avoid batching updates that cause outdated profiles by prioritizing streaming updates.
  • Overcomplex Rules: Simplify rule sets and rely on machine learning for complex decisions to reduce processing time.
  • Scaling Issues: Use auto-scaling and load balancing to handle traffic spikes, avoiding bottlenecks during high demand.

5. Designing and Testing Micro-Targeted Content Variations

a) Creating Variations Based on User Profile and Context

Develop a modular content system where different components (images, headlines, CTAs) are stored as interchangeable modules. Use user attributes (location, device type, behavioral segments) and contextual signals (time of day, traffic source) to assemble personalized variations. For example, show a mobile-optimized product carousel for mobile users or tailored promotional banners for high-value segments.

b) A/B Testing Strategies for Micro-Targeted Content

Implement multi-armed bandit algorithms to allocate traffic dynamically based on ongoing performance. Segment your audience into micro-groups and run parallel tests of different variations. Use statistical significance metrics (e.g., p-value < 0.05) to determine winning variations. Regularly rotate or refresh content variations to prevent fatigue and maintain relevance.

c) Measuring Engagement and Conversion Metrics for Fine-Tuned Optimization

Track KPIs such as dwell time, click-through rate, bounce rate, and conversion rate at the segment level. Use event tracking and heatmaps to understand user interactions. Employ attribution models that assign credit to specific content variations, enabling iterative refinement based on what truly drives engagement.

Fundamentals of Light and Color: From Physics to Perception

At the core of our visual experience lies the electromagnetic spectrum, a range of waves that includes radio waves, microwaves, infrared, visible light, ultraviolet, X-rays, and gamma rays. Human eyes are sensitive only to a narrow band called visible light, spanning approximately 380 to 740 nanometers. Within this range, our brains interpret signals received by specialized cells in the retina—rods and cones—allowing us to perceive a rich palette of colors.

Color perception is further explained through models like RGB (Red, Green, Blue) and C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black). RGB, for example, combines three primary colors of light to produce a broad spectrum of hues on digital screens. When light reflects off surfaces, the interplay of illumination, material properties, and surface geometry determines the colors we ultimately see. This process is fundamental in everything from natural scenes to the rendering techniques used in digital media.

The electromagnetic spectrum and human perception

Spectrum Range Wavelength (nm) Perceived Color
Ultraviolet 10-380 Invisible
Visible Light 380-740 Colors from violet to red
Infrared 740-1000 Invisible

The Spectrum of Light and Its Digital Representation

While the physical spectrum is continuous, digital systems encode colors discretely. This distinction is crucial for rendering images that appear seamless to the human eye. Digital color models divide the spectrum into specific values—such as 256 levels per channel in 8-bit RGB—allowing devices to represent millions of colors.

Color spaces like RGB and HSV (Hue, Saturation, Value) organize how colors are stored and manipulated. RGB is additive, meaning combining red, green, and blue light yields white, whereas CMYK is subtractive, used primarily in printing. Accurate color reproduction across devices relies on understanding and converting between these spaces, which is vital in gaming and digital media where visual consistency enhances user experience.

Color spaces and encoding

  • RGB: Used in screens and digital displays, combines red, green, and blue channels.
  • HSV: Focuses on hue, saturation, and brightness, useful for intuitive adjustments.
  • Other models: CMYK for printing, LAB for perceptual uniformity.

Mathematical Foundations of Color and Light Manipulation

Digital systems rely heavily on mathematics to process and manipulate color data. Boolean algebra and digital logic underpin the design of color processing hardware, enabling operations like blending, masking, and filtering. For example, combining binary signals allows for complex image transformations essential in real-time rendering.

Transformations like gamma correction adjust luminance to match human perception, which is non-linear. Statistical models, particularly the normal distribution, influence display calibration by characterizing how noise and color inaccuracies distribute across pixels, ensuring consistent visual quality.

Transformations and statistical models

  • Color correction algorithms often utilize matrix transformations based on linear algebra.
  • Filtering techniques, such as Gaussian blur, rely on probability distributions to reduce noise.
  • Gamma correction employs exponential functions to align digital luminance with human perception.

Light Physics in Virtual Environments

Simulating realistic lighting in digital environments involves mimicking physical light behavior. Ray tracing, inspired by the paths of light rays in nature, calculates how light interacts with surfaces—reflections, refractions, and shadows—to produce highly realistic images. These algorithms analyze each pixel by tracing potential light paths, resulting in immersive visuals that closely resemble real-world scenes.

Advanced rendering techniques incorporate algorithms that simulate complex phenomena like global illumination, where light bounces multiple times, enriching the scene’s realism. This depth of detail is what makes modern video games visually compelling, drawing players into believable worlds.

Rendering techniques and realism

  • Ray tracing models physical light paths for accurate reflections and shadows.
  • Global illumination algorithms simulate indirect light bouncing.
  • Combining shading models with physics-based calculations enhances visual fidelity.

From Spectrum to Screen: Color Rendering in Digital Devices

Converting physical light into digital signals involves sensors capturing light intensity and color, then encoding this information into digital data. Calibration ensures that different devices—monitors, smartphones, VR headsets—display consistent colors. This process is vital in gaming, where visual fidelity directly impacts user immersion.

Despite advancements, challenges remain in maintaining color accuracy across diverse hardware. Technologies like color management systems and standardized color profiles help mitigate discrepancies, ensuring that the vibrant visuals created by sophisticated rendering algorithms are faithfully reproduced.

Color matching and calibration challenges

  • Differences in display technologies (LCD, OLED) affect color rendering.
  • Ambient lighting influences perceived color accuracy.
  • Calibration tools and standards are essential for consistency in digital media production.
